您可以使用g_timeout_addg_timeout_add_seconds来定期调用超时函数。 请注意,此超时function可能会因事件处理而延迟,因此不应依赖于精确计时。 有关主循环的更多信息,请查看此开发人员页面 。
这是一个让你入门的例子(你可以通过这种方式即兴发挥)。 在示例中,超时设置为秒,因此使用g_timeout_add_seconds ,如果需要毫秒精度,请使用g_timeout_add

 #include  #include  #include  /* Determines if to continue the timer or not */ static gboolean continue_timer = FALSE; /* Determines if the timer has started */ static gboolean start_timer = FALSE; /* Display seconds expired */ static int sec_expired = 0; static void _quit_cb (GtkWidget *button, gpointer data) { (void)button; (void)data; /*Avoid compiler warnings*/ gtk_main_quit(); return; } static gboolean _label_update(gpointer data) { GtkLabel *label = (GtkLabel*)data; char buf[256]; memset(&buf, 0x0, 256); snprintf(buf, 255, "Time elapsed: %d secs", ++sec_expired); gtk_label_set_label(label, buf); return continue_timer; } static void _start_timer (GtkWidget *button, gpointer data) { (void)button;/*Avoid compiler warnings*/ GtkWidget *label = data; if(!start_timer) { g_timeout_add_seconds(1, _label_update, label); start_timer = TRUE; continue_timer = TRUE; } } static void _pause_resume_timer (GtkWidget *button, gpointer data) { (void)button;/*Avoid compiler warnings*/ if(start_timer) { GtkWidget *label = data; continue_timer = !continue_timer; if(continue_timer) { g_timeout_add_seconds(1, _label_update, label); } else { /*Decrementing because timer will be hit one more time before expiring*/ sec_expired--; } } } static void _reset_timer (GtkWidget *button, gpointer data) { (void)button; (void)data;/*Avoid compiler warnings*/ /*Setting to -1 instead of 0, because timer will be triggered once more before expiring*/ sec_expired = -1; continue_timer = FALSE; start_timer = FALSE; } int main(void) { GtkWidget *window; GtkWidget *vbox; GtkWidget *start_button; GtkWidget *pause_resume_button; GtkWidget *reset_button; GtkWidget *quit_button; GtkWidget *label; gtk_init(NULL, NULL); window = gtk_window_new(GTK_WINDOW_TOPLEVEL); g_signal_connect (G_OBJECT (window), "destroy", G_CALLBACK (gtk_main_quit), NULL); vbox = gtk_vbox_new (FALSE, 2); gtk_container_add(GTK_CONTAINER(window), vbox); label = gtk_label_new("Time elapsed: 0 secs"); start_button = gtk_button_new_with_label("Start"); g_signal_connect(G_OBJECT(start_button), "clicked", G_CALLBACK(_start_timer), label); pause_resume_button = gtk_button_new_with_label("Pause/Resume"); g_signal_connect(G_OBJECT(pause_resume_button), "clicked", G_CALLBACK(_pause_resume_timer), label); reset_button = gtk_button_new_with_label("Reset"); g_signal_connect(G_OBJECT(reset_button), "clicked", G_CALLBACK(_reset_timer), label); quit_button = gtk_button_new_with_label("Quit"); g_signal_connect(G_OBJECT(quit_button), "clicked", G_CALLBACK(_quit_cb), NULL); gtk_box_pack_start (GTK_BOX(vbox), label, 0, 0, 0); gtk_box_pack_start (GTK_BOX(vbox), start_button, 0, 0, 0); gtk_box_pack_start (GTK_BOX(vbox), pause_resume_button, 0, 0, 0); gtk_box_pack_start (GTK_BOX(vbox), reset_button, 0, 0, 0); gtk_box_pack_start (GTK_BOX (vbox), quit_button, 0, 0, 0); gtk_widget_show_all(window); g_timeout_add_seconds(1, _label_update, label); continue_timer = TRUE; start_timer = TRUE; gtk_main(); return 0; }
